Comparison review

Motorola Moto Z Force Droid Edition has a general score of 76.4, which is just a bit better than HTC 10's 75.7 overall score. Even though Motorola Moto Z Force Droid Edition and HTC 10 were released with only 3 months difference, the Motorola Moto Z Force Droid Edition body is just a little bit heavier but thinner than HTC 10.

Motorola Moto Z Force Droid Edition counts with a CPU that is very similar to HTC 10's processor, both of them have the same number of cores and 4 GB of RAM. The HTC 10 counts with a bit sharper display than Motorola Moto Z Force Droid Edition, because although it has a little bit smaller screen, and they both have the same exact resolution of 1440 x 2560, the HTC 10 also counts with a just a bit better pixels density.

HTC 10 features a little bit better camera than Motorola Moto Z Force Droid Edition, although it has a camera in the back with way less megapixels resolution and a worse video resolution, they both have a F1.8 camera aperture. Motorola Moto Z Force Droid Edition features a better storage capacity to install applications and games or saving photos and videos than HTC 10, and although they both have a SD memory slot that allows a maximum of 1,95 TB, the Motorola Moto Z Force Droid Edition also has 32 GB more internal memory.

The Motorola Moto Z Force Droid Edition features a little longer battery lifetime than HTC 10, because it has a 3500mAh battery capacity.
